The x-values are sequential, so we can look at the y-values.

Differences from one to the next are ...

-7, -1, 5, 11, 17

And the differences of these numbers are ...

6, 6, 6, 6

When second differences are constant, the sequence can be produced by a second-degree (quadratic) polynomial.

__

Here, that polynomial is ...

y = 3x² +2x -1

The regression functions of a graphing calculator can help you find the appropriate formula.
